Interventions
- Electrofulguration (EF) — PROCEDURENitrofurantoin (NF) daily antibiotic prophylaxis for 6 months plus Electrofulguration.
- Nitrofurantoin (NF) — DRUGNitrofurantoin (NF) daily antibiotic prophylaxis given daily for 6 months.
Study Details
The goal of this clinical trial is to learn if the drug Nitrofurantoin (NF) taken as a daily antibiotic, works to treat cystitis compared to electrofulguration (EF) and Nitrofurantoin (NF) daily antibiotic.

Arms
- Active Comparator: Nitrofurantoin (NF) daily antibiotic prophylaxisNitrofurantoin (NF) daily antibiotic prophylaxis given daily for 6 months.
- Experimental: Nitrofurantoin (NF) daily antibiotic prophylaxis plus electrofulguration (EF)
Primary Outcome Measure
Treatment of cystitis with NF vs EF+NF [ Time Frame: Baseline to 30 months after enrollment to completion of study ]
